People at AIPT

AIPT (the Association for International Practical Training)  has more than 40 employees who bring a wide range of talents to every project. AIPT's experienced staff includes quality leadership, as well as talented administrators and support staff.

Executive Staff

Elizabeth Chazottes, President and CEO
An AIPT director since 1987, Chazottes was appointed to the position of chief executive officer by the association's board of directors in May of 1996. 

With more than 35 years of experience in the field of education and training, Chazottes has specialized in international human resource development and training issues. She has eight years of European human resources experience with an emphasis on recruiting and training as well as expatriate issues. She serves as the chair of the Alliance for International Educational Exchange, an advocacy and policy coalition group of nonprofit international educational and cultural exchange organizations. Chazottes is also active in the American Society of Association Executives’ International Section; the Society for Human Resource Management; and NAFSA: Association of International Educators; among other organizations.

Chazottes has a bachelor’s degree in education from Miami University (Ohio) and a master’s degree in personnel and counseling from Southern Connecticut State University. She is married with two children.
